What Is Rice Water and Why Is It Beneficial for Skin?

What Is Rice Water?

Rice water is the starchy liquid you get after soaking or cooking rice. It is rich in nutrients like v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ants. Thanks to this nutritional content, it works wonders in supporting your skin’s health. By incorporating natural skincare with rice water, you can treat your skin to a boost of hydration and a brighter glow.

Benefits of Rice Water for Skin

There are many benefits of rice water for skin. Here are a few highlights:

  • Hydration: Helps lock in moisture, keeping your skin supple.
  • Brightening Effect: Promotes a natural radiance and evens out your skin tone.
  • Anti-Ageing Properties: Reduces the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les.
  • Soothing Irritated Skin: Calms redness and discomfort, especially for rice water for sensitive skin.
  • Acne Control: Manages oil production, making it ideal for rice water for acne-prone skin.

How to Prepare Rice Water for Skincare

Methods to Prepare Rice Water

You can prepare rice water in a few simple ways, depending on your skincare needs:

  • Soaking Method: Rinse a cup of rice and soak it in 2-3 cups of water for about 30 minutes. Stir occasionally. Strain the water to use as a DIY rice water toner.
  • Boiling Method: Boil rice with extra water. Once done, strain the water; this nutrient-rich liquid can be used for a homemade rice water face mask.
  • Fermentation Method: Leave the soaked rice water in a warm place for 24-48 hours to ferment. This method can be great for rice water for acne-prone skin and rice water for skin whitening due to enhanced potency.

How to Use Rice Water for Skincare

DIY Rice Water Toner

After cleansing, saturate a cotton pad with rice water and gently swipe it over your face. This DIY rice water toner helps to balance your skin’s pH, tighten pores and deliver hydration.

Homemade Rice Water Face Mask

Mix rice water with a spoonful of honey or aloe vera gel. Apply evenly to your face and leave on for about 15-20 minutes before rinsing off. This homemade rice water face mask is perfect for brightening your complexion and calming sensitive skin.

Rice Water for Acne-Prone Skin

For those with acne, using rice water as a spot treatment or rinse can be incredibly soothing. It helps control excess oil while reducing inflammation, making it a great addition to your routine if you’re tackling breakouts.

Rice Water for Skin Whitening

If you’re looking to reduce dark spots and achieve a more even skin tone, rice water for skin whitening may be worth trying. Regular application can help lighten hyperpigmentation and give your skin a refreshing glow. Simply dab on the fermented rice water or mix it into your routine as a toner.

Rice Water Skincare Routine

Incorporating rice water into your daily routine is easy. Here’s a simple skincare routine to try:

  • Step 1: Cleanse your face with rice water to gently remove impurities.
  • Step 2: Tone your skin with rice water, balancing pH and hydrating your cells.
  • Step 3: Apply a rice water face mask once a week for added brightness and calm.
  • Step 4: Moisturise and protect your skin as the final touch.

Are There Any Side Effects of Using Rice Water on Skin?

While rice water is generally kind to most skin types, some may experience dryness or irritation. For rice water for sensitive skin, it’s wise to conduct a patch test before using it across your face. Adjust the frequency of use if any discomfort occurs, and enjoy the soothing benefits at a pace that feels right for you.
